by Lowlander » Wed Dec 12, 2012 11:54 am

There is no way to do what you ask. The forum is a public place on the internet which gets indexed by the search engines so it can be found. Other than making the forum invisible to search engines there is no way and this would be bad for business as less people would find MediaMonkey. Also it would make searching the forum more difficult as it's often easier to find thing through Google than the forum search.
If you don't want to be found on the internet you shouldn't put anything on the internet. This is what you always need to remember when you put anything on the internet.
